Stepping away from the cameras, Egeliler chose a life of quiet serenity. She moved to Bursa and married Fahri Balcı, a nightclub owner. The couple had a son, Erhan Balcı, and lived a life far removed from the chaos of Istanbul's film scene. After her husband's passing in 2017, she continued to live a private life away from the public eye.

In the mid-1970s, Yeşilçam faced a severe financial crisis. The widespread introduction of television in Turkish households caused a massive drop in theater attendance. Concurrently, political instability, strict censorship laws, and rising production costs pushed traditional filmmakers to the brink of bankruptcy.
